During a new interview for Her Money, Her Power, Nollywood powerhouse couple Linda Ejiofor and Ibrahim Suleiman talked about finances in their marriage, and during the course of the conversation, actress Linda Ejiofor opened up about the lifestyle change that her husband Ibrahim Suleiman adviced her to make; and spoke about how she was thankful to him for doing that, and how it really helped her. Here’s what Linda Ejiofor had to say.

During the interview when asked “What money challenge were you able to get rid of due to your husband’s support?” Linda Ejiofor opened up about the lifestyle change her husband Ibrahim Suleiman made her make saying:

LINDA EJIOFOR: So, when we just started dating and we became really serious without the public knowing, he found out that I wasn’t saving. Like, I would make money and I didn’t have a savings. I had an account where money and salary would enter, but I didn’t have savings that I would keep for a rainy day or anything. I was just spending.

This man came into my life and was like “what? Wait, what? You don’t have savings?” He now sat me down and made me do the calculations of how much I would make in a year, and he was like “no, no, you can’t do this.” And so, he made me open another account which would be one for my salary account, and then I would take a percentage of that money and put it into the new account which I just got and that one was for never touching. That’s for rainy day and all. Then, that one that was for touching was for miscellaneous. I can use and spend. That was my money.

So yeah, I think that was one thing I didn’t know. I didn’t know I could do that. I just wanted to LIVE LIFE. But then, he helped me.
